An analysis typically includes a detailed examination of data, information, or a situation to uncover patterns, trends, relationships, or insights. It involves breaking down complex elements into smaller parts to better understand them and draw conclusions or make recommendations based on the findings. The analysis process often includes identifying key factors, evaluating evidence, interpreting results, and presenting conclusions in a meaningful way.

Why are internal forces not included in an equation of motion analysis, considering that the internal forces are?

Internal forces are not included in an equation of motion analysis because they cancel each other out within the system. This means that the effects of internal forces on the motion of an object are already accounted for and do not need to be separately considered in the analysis.
